To develop novel antibiotics, targeting the early steps
of cell
wall peptidoglycan biosynthesis seems to be a promising strategy that
is still underutilized. MurA, the first enzyme in this pathway, is
targeted by the clinically used irreversible inhibitor fosfomycin.
However, mutations in its binding site can cause bacterial resistance.
We herein report a series of novel reversible pyrrolidinedione-based
MurA inhibitors that equally inhibit wild type (WT) MurA and the fosfomycin-resistant
MurA C115D mutant, showing an additive effect with fosfomycin for
the inhibition of WT MurA. For the most potent inhibitor 46 (IC50 = 4.5 μM), the mode of inhibition was analyzed
using native mass spectrometry and protein NMR spectroscopy. The compound
class was nontoxic against human cells and highly stable in human
S9 fraction, human plasma, and bacterial cell lysate. Taken together,
this novel compound class might be further developed toward antibiotic
drug candidates that inhibit cell wall
synthesis.
